In a modern application you will have a dashboard area where you can admin several things such as a Post creation , delete and update.
This behavior we will also implement in this chapter.
First we will create secure routes which requires the user to be authenticated , otherwise the router will send the user to a login form.
If authentication is successful the user is send to a dashboard , where he will see the index of all his posts in a table.
for each post in table we will have a edit and delete button.
and on top of the table a create new button
This are 3 different actions and 2 different pages ( for delete we dont need a page )
We will create 2 routes for both new and delete

The title of the chapter i pretty obvious . So mostly at the time the create and edit pages ( views ) are almost the same . That why we will use same html for both pages. the create Page is simple a form witch on submit will send data to api , here but we will implement a simple validation for :
Title- cant be blank and cant be longer then 150 charsDescriptionnot longer then 1000
For edit page we will first fetch data for the corresponding post and update with that data the form , then on form submit we will send the new data. validation same here.
